Gulf College (GC), Centro Franco Omanais (CFO) and the Persian Language Centre (PLC) have collaboratively launched the French and Persian language courses on the 22nd of October 2017 to benefit the internal and external clientele. With the aim to equip the students with multilinguistic and multicultural knowledge and skills, they have opened the gateway to more advantageous human pursuits in business, education and personal development. GC Centre for Languages and Cultural Studies Manager, Dr. Irene Pineda Villareal works closely with CFO French Instructor, Mr. Hassan Al Ramadhani and PLC Persian Instructor, Ms. Marzieh Moghadas in the delivery of French and Persian language courses. It is worth mentioning that the clients hold positions as Senior Manager for Administration and Corporate Affairs at the Port of Duqm, Customer Service Supervisor at Oman Air, Senior Staff Member in the Sales Department of Oreedoo, and Researcher at Sultan Qaboos University. One client is a Master in Law and still another works in DIWAN. GC’s centre manager, quality assurance coordinator, faculty administrator and lecturer have joined the batch. This culturally diversified group of Omanis, Americans, Filipinos, Iranian, and Sudanese is on the beat to make its social impact in the global community. Vital learning sessions at Gulf College are held on Sundays and Tuesdays from 4:30pm to 6:30pm in S3 for French and from 6:00pm to 8:00pm in S4 for Farsi.
